Ceisteanna—Questions. Oral Answers. - Food Advisory Committee.

1.

Mr. Ryan

asked the Minister for Health if it is intended to implement the recommendations of the Food Advisory Committee regarding the manufacture of food and drink referred to in a statement of the Government Information Bureau quoted in a Dublin newspaper on 23rd April last, and, if so, when.

I have accepted generally the recommendations made to me by the Food Advisory Committee regarding the presence of preservatives and colouring matters in food intended for human consumption, and draft regulations had been prepared to give effect to this decision. Before submitting them to the other Government Departments concerned and the National Health Council, the draft regulations had to be further examined as some doubts arose as to the legal authority for the implementation of some of the recommendations of the Committee. These matters have now been disposed of and amended draft regulations are being prepared, which, at the request of the Food Advisory Committee, will be submitted to that Committee for its further consideration. In the meantime the earlier regulations remain in operation.
